Meaning of "dallier" in English

In English, the word "dallier" refers to someone who wastes time or delays action unnecessarily. This term is often used to describe a person who procrastinates, loiters, or lingers without a clear purpose. It implies a sense of idleness and lack of urgency, suggesting that the person is either hesitant to commit to a task or simply enjoys leisure time without progressing. The word originates from the verb "dally," which means to act or move slowly, waste time, or engage in playful behavior.
